It's summer! -- The longest day is here -- It's heating up -- Summer colors -- Green leaves -- Time to leave home -- Taking off! -- Tiny signs of summer -- summer in a garden -- Science lab -- Science words
Describes some of the signs of summer, including changes in light and temperature, plants in flower, green leaves, young animals starting on their own, and other differences, and suggests related activities
